Most powerful ways to connect Shippo and Microsoft OneDrive

Shippo + Microsoft OneDrive + Google Sheets: When a new shipping label is generated in Shippo, it's automatically downloaded and uploaded to a designated folder in Microsoft OneDrive for archiving. Simultaneously, key details about the shipment, such as tracking number and recipient address, are added as a new row to a Google Sheet for expense tracking and record-keeping.

Microsoft OneDrive + Shippo + Slack: When a new delivery confirmation document is uploaded to a specific folder in Microsoft OneDrive, the system finds the associated order in Shippo. A Slack message is then sent to a predefined channel, alerting the team about the delivery and providing a direct link to the confirmation document.

Are there any limitations to the Shippo and Microsoft OneDrive integration on Latenode?

While the integration is powerful, there are certain limitations to be aware of:

  • Large file transfers to OneDrive may be subject to OneDrive's API limits.
  • Shippo API rate limits may affect the frequency of data retrieval.
  • Complex data transformations may require custom JavaScript code.
